Section 4.
The validity of the public debt of the USA, authorized by law, including debts incurred for payment of pensions and bounties for services in suppressing insurrection or rebellion, shall not be questioned. But neither the USA nor any state shall assume or pay any debt or obligation incurred in aid of insurrection or rebellion against the USA, or any claim for the loss or emancipation of any slave; but all such debts, obligations and claims shall be held illegal and void.
